Nissan plans to purchase batteries from South Korean battery maker SK on for electric vehicles in the U.S. market starting in 2028. SK on will supply 20 gigawatt-hours (GWh) of electric vehicle batteries worth 2.5 trillion won (about $1.7 billion) to Nissan's U.S. auto plants, which is enough to power about 300,000 standard electric vehicles. The two companies are currently adjusting the details of the contract.
